Local Nurseries and Garden Centers
One of the best places to purchase a Portulaca plant is at your local nurseries or garden centers. These establishments specialize in providing a wide range of plants and gardening supplies, making them an ideal choice for finding specific species like Portulaca. Visit your nearest nursery or garden center and look for their outdoor or indoor plant sections, where you are likely to find these plants displayed.
The advantage of buying from local nurseries and garden centers is that you can physically inspect the plants before making a purchase. Check for signs of healthy growth, such as lush green leaves and unblemished flowers. Additionally, knowledgeable staff members can provide valuable advice on caring for the plant and answer any questions you may have.
Online Plant Retailers
In recent years, online plant retailers have gained popularity as a convenient option for purchasing plants, including Portulacas. These websites offer a wide variety of plants, allowing you to browse through different options and choose the one that suits your preferences. Some well-known online plant retailers include The Sill, Bloomscape, and Etsy.
When purchasing online, it is important to read customer reviews and ratings to ensure that the retailer has a good reputation for delivering healthy plants. Look for detailed descriptions of the Portulaca plants they offer, including information on size, color variations, and care requirements. Additionally, check if the retailer provides guarantees or refunds in case the plant arrives damaged or unhealthy.

Plant Exchanges and Local Gardening Groups
If you are looking for a more cost-effective option or want to connect with fellow gardening enthusiasts, consider joining local gardening groups or participating in plant exchanges. These groups often organize events where members can trade or sell plants, including Portulacas.
Check if your community has any gardening clubs or associations through local directories or social media platforms. Attending these events not only allows you to purchase a Portulaca plant but also enables you to learn from experienced gardeners and share your own knowledge.
